Daniel Hill wins national award

DANIEL Hill from SPAR Lambeg, Lisburn, has been announced best sales assistant in the multiple symbol sector and is through to the finals of the Sales Assistant of the Year Awards 2012.

The national competition, organised by Convenience Store magazine, celebrates the very best that the UK has to offer in terms of customer service, community interaction, and business achievement.

To reach the finals, Daniel had to submit a written entry, before a judging visit and face-to-face interview were carried out at his workplace.

“Daniel has wowed the judges with his tremendous commitment to customer service and thorough professionalism at work,” said Convenience Store editor David Rees.

“We look forward to welcoming him to our finals ceremony in London where the judges will have an extremely difficult job to decide which one of our five outstanding category winners will gain the prestigious title of Sales Assistant of the Year 2012,” he added.

The awards take place on November 13 at the Dorchester Hotel in London where Daniel will be awarded £500 in prize money for reaching the finals, and have the chance to win a further £500 if he is crowned the overall winner.

On the morning of the awards Daniel and four other sector winners will be interviewed by a judging panel before one of them is awarded Sales Assistant of the Year at a special ceremony, hosted by TV personality Cheryl Baker.
